What is FF level?

Ff, or “flatness F-Number,” defines the maximum floor curvature allowed over 24″ (600 mm) computed on the basis of successive 12″ (300 mm) elevation differentials. Fl, or “levelness F-Number,” defines the relative conformity of the floor surface to a horizontal plane as measured over a 10′ (3.03m) distance.

How is FF measured?

FF and FL are measured using either the Dipstick from Face Construction Technologies or the F-meter from Allen Face & Company. The Dipstick was the original device used to measure these values and is stepped across the floor. The F-meter rolls along a defined line.

What is super flat floor?

Superflat is a generic term given to a high tolerance floor for VNA applications. A Defined Traffic path occurs when material handling equipment moves up and down the floor in precisely the same wheel position each time.

How flat should a concrete slab be?

Classifying Concrete Floors Based on Flatness and Levelness

CLASSIFICATION SPECIFIED OVERALL FLATNESS (SOFF) SPECIFIED OVERALL LEVELNESS (SOFL)
Moderately Flat 25 20
Flat 35 25
Very Flat 45 35
Super Flat 60 40

What does FFFF fl mean in construction?

FF/FL numbers Floor flatness (F F) controls the bumpiness of the floor surface and is primarily affected by the finishing operations after screeding, including restraightening and power floating. Essentially, F F numbers evaluate the elevation differences along a sample line at one-foot intervals.

What does FF mean in floor measurement?

Essentially, FF numbers evaluate the elevation differences along a sample line at 1-foot intervals. F numbers extend from zero to infinity so the higher the F number, the flatter the floor. Floor levelness (FL) controls the departure of the floor surface from the specified slope or plane of the surface.

What is floor flatness (FF F)?

F F numbers depict the Floor Flatness, or how close to planar the floor is. In other words, Floor Flatness is a statistical measurement of how wavy or bumpy a concrete floor is and takes into account the amplitude (height if the waves) and the wavelength (horizontal distance between waves).
